Job DescriptionJob Title: Tig WelderJob Description
We are currently seeking a dedicated Tig Welder to join our team. This role involves performing TIG welding tasks specifically on temperature sensors and thermowells for a diverse range of clients. The welder will be provided with a personal welding booth, comprehensive writing instructions, and daily work orders. Expect to engage in welds on sensors, working with stainless tubes and powder packed wires, and sandblasting to weld a fitting or flange onto proprietary casings.
